3 Best Shichimi Togarashi Brands. But the origin of Shichimi Togarashi dates back to about 400 years ago, and several long-established spice shops have become famous for the spice mix. Among others, the ones generally known as Japan's 3 Best Shichimi Brands are Yagenbori (やげん堀), Yawataya Isogoro (八幡礒五郎), and Shichimiya Honpo.

Shichimi togarashi is a powdered spice mix. It's sprinkled over ramen, udon and soba noodles, gyudon, tonjiru, yakitori, and hot pot dishes. It's a pantry staple, an all-purpose condiment, and a finishing seasoning. There are regional differences in the balance and differences of ingredients, such as the addition of yuzu peel, shiso leaves.

06-To Add To Salads. Another great and simple way to use shichimi togarashi is to mix it with salads, vinaigrettes, and salad dressings. The flavor combination of this blend perfectly complements both fresh and cooked salads. You can stir in this mixture with olive oil, rice vinegar, honey, lemon juice, etc., to make a delicious salad dressing.

In a spice grinder (or coffee grinder, mortar and pestle), grind the chili flakes, peppercorns and orange peel into a fine powder. Add the nori and pulse a few times to break up, leaving small pieces, not completely ground. Transfer ground mixture to a bowl and stir through the ground ginger and both sesame seeds.

Togarashi, also named Shichimi Togarashi, is a highly popular Japanese spice blend. It is used as an everyday condiment in Japan and can be compared to salt and pepper in the Western cooking world. Togarashi means 'peppers', which is the basic ingredient of the mix, and Shichimi translates to 'seven', the exact number of spices included.

Shichimi togarashi adds a savory, citrusy, and spicy essence to many meals. The most common use of togarashi is for spicing up soup dishes such as ramen, udon, soba, and miso soup. It's also used to jazz up meat dishes like yakitori, gyudon, or steak. It's sometimes sprinkled on top of grilled fish, including salmon and other seafood.
